# 302.21 Appearances.

(a) Any party to a proceeding may appear and be heard in person or by a designated representative.

(b) No register of persons who may practice before the Department is maintained and no application for admission to practice is required.

(c) Any person practicing or desiring to practice before the Department may, upon hearing and good cause shown, be suspended or barred from practicing.
